從遠(yuǎn)程存儲庫(Git)拉取更改
如果您的團(tuán)隊(duì)中的某個(gè)人對您的遠(yuǎn)程存儲庫進(jìn)行了更改棒掠,那么您需要在本地進(jìn)行更改烟很。
- 在SourceTree的存儲庫中,單擊 Pull 按鈕恤筛。
一個(gè)彈出窗口似乎表明您正在將文件從Bitbucket合并到本地存儲庫毒坛。
- 從此彈出窗口中單擊“ 確定”煎殷。
- 導(dǎo)航到本地系統(tǒng)上的存儲庫文件夾豪直,您將看到剛剛添加的文件弓乙。 SourceTree更新與歷史記錄視圖中的新文件
提交和推動變更(Git)
當(dāng)您將新文件添加到存儲庫或進(jìn)行更改時(shí),需要對該遠(yuǎn)程存儲庫進(jìn)行分段垢乙,提交和推送追逮。在您進(jìn)行更改后钮孵,您將在SourceTree中注意到您的新文件巴席。
或
- 從新文件的選項(xiàng)菜單中荧库,選擇 舞臺文件分衫。
- 單擊 頂部的 提交按鈕提交文件牵现。
- 在消息框中瞎疼,輸入提交消息贼急。
- 單擊 框下的提交按鈕竿裂。您現(xiàn)在可以在“ 歷史記錄” 鏈接下查看更改 照弥。
- 從SourceTree这揣,點(diǎn)擊 按下 按鈕给赞,把你提交的修改片迅。
- 在 推柑蛇? 列出現(xiàn)的對話框中耻台,選擇主分支表示您正在將該分支推送到原點(diǎn)盆耽,然后單擊 確定扼菠。
創(chuàng)建并將分支推送到遠(yuǎn)程存儲庫(Git)
當(dāng)您開始新的功能時(shí)析恢,您可能需要創(chuàng)建一個(gè)分支氮昧。分支提供了一種在一行代碼上工作的方式,而不影響主代碼庫咪辱。
- 從SourceTree油狂,單擊 分支 按鈕专筷。
- 從“ 新建分支” 字段中磷蛹,輸入您的分支的名稱味咳。
- 單擊 創(chuàng)建分支槽驶。
- 你現(xiàn)在在你的新分支掂铐。對您要分支的存儲庫進(jìn)行任何更新全陨。
- 在SourceTree中打開“ 歷史記錄”視圖烤镐,并注意到您的存儲庫現(xiàn)在有未提交的更改炮叶。
- 從文件的選項(xiàng)菜單中選擇 舞臺文件渡处。
- 單擊 頂部的 提交按鈕提交文件侣肄。
- 在消息框中稼锅,輸入提交消息。
- 單擊 框下的提交按鈕矩距。從SourceTree 歷史記錄中锥债,您將看到該文件已在新分支上更新哮肚。
- 點(diǎn)擊 按下 按鈕,您的新分支推到倉庫恼策。
- 在 ** 推戏蔑?** 列從出現(xiàn)的對話框中選擇您的新分支,以指示您將該分支推送到原點(diǎn)鳍寂,然后單擊 確定。
新版本改成現(xiàn)在的樣子,選中那個(gè)推送到哪個(gè)
- 單擊 確定 按鈕將更改推送到本地存儲庫鹃觉。
將更改從一個(gè)分支合并到另一個(gè)分支(Git)
如果功能分支落后 master盗扇,您可以使用合并將該分支同步到您的要素分支中沉填。
- 從左側(cè)菜單中翼闹,將鼠標(biāo)懸停在“ 分支” 標(biāo)簽的右側(cè)猎荠, 直到看到“ 顯示”。
- 單擊 顯示 以展開分支列表荒叶。
- 雙擊要切換到該分支的功能分支停撞。
- 單擊 合并 按鈕戈毒。
- 從出現(xiàn)的彈出窗口中,選擇要合并到您的要素分支中的提交冠桃。
- 檢查“ 創(chuàng)建提交”,即使通過 底部的快進(jìn)選項(xiàng)進(jìn)行合并解決污茵。
- 單擊 確定泞当。
您的功能部門現(xiàn)在具有與您的master 分支相同的提交 。